General Description and Classification Standards
The purpose of this job is to inspect construction job sites and approved plans to ensure compliance with regulatory codes, ordinances, and laws. Duties include, but are not limited to: reading fire sprinkler plans and specifications and inspect installation at job site to be in compliance with plans and regulatory codes, ordinances and laws; assisting fire sprinkler installers with NFPA code conformation; answering inquiries regarding construction materials and procedures; explaining departmental procedures; and processing paperwork.

Duties are performed with considerable initiative and independent judgment under the direction of the division manager. The incumbent must ensure that best in class customer service is provided to both internal and external customers, and embrace, support, and promote the City's core values, beliefs, and culture.

EssentialDuties&ResponsibilitiesThesearetypicalresponsibilitiesforthispositionandshouldnotbeconstruedasexclusive or all inclusive. Other duties may be required and assigned.

Performs skilled inspection work in the enforcement of municipal ordinances and regulations which govern the installation and modification of Water-Based Fire Protection Systems, Foam water systems, FM 200 systems, and Halon systems;

Performs review to ensure fire sprinkler, fire pumps, backflow preventer and standpipe installations are in compliance with approved plans, specifications, and City of Atlanta codes and regulations regarding NFPA 13, 13R, 13D, 14, 20, 25, and 72 installations requirements.

Investigates suspected unlicensed installers or unpermitted work;

Ability to assist a high volume of fire sprinkler installers, and customers in conformity with NFPA 13, 13R and 13D installations requirements/regulations;

Communication:

Confers with supervisor, Inspectors, contractors, the general public and others regarding code interpretations, and related issues.

Ability to provide code interpretation or other assistance to contractors, engineers, the general public, and others as necessary at job site;

Problem Identification and Solution:

Studies, interprets, and ensures Fire sprinkler/suppression systems are adhered to in designs.

Has considerable knowledge of hydraulics, hazard evaluation, detection systems, Fire sprinkler control valve assembly, stand pipe design, Wet pipe systems, Deluge systems, Dry pipe systems, Pre-Action

Systems, Foam water systems, FM 200 systems, Halon systems, EFSR systems, as well as NFPA 13, 13R and 13D installations requirements.
